What Is Welded Gabion?
welding Galvanized Gabion

Welded Gabion

 

     Contemporary welded gabion assemblies employ precisely fabricated, rigid cellular structures. Production leverages advanced methods, joining zinc-coated steel mesh sections seamlessly at all connection points to ensure exact alignment and robust load-bearing capacity. These constructions integrate durable rock infill, delivering adaptable solutions across diverse uses: geotechnical reinforcement (encompassing slope stabilization and erosion prevention), building envelopes, landscape architecture, and watercourse protection.

     Contrasting with conventional wire baskets, this welded design delivers enhanced load dispersion and a consistent aesthetic. Simultaneously, the permeable stone matrix facilitates efficient hydraulic management, increased deployment versatility, and effortless blending with the natural environment-establishing them as an eco-compatible infrastructure option for development and habitat enhancement projects.

1.Q: What steps are involved in building Welded Gabions?
    A: These structures are made up of factory-manufactured, stiff steel mesh panels with welded links. Once positioned, they are filled with rocks or long-lasting aggregates. Their welded structure sets them apart from woven ones, and they are used in erosion prevention, slope strengthening, landscaping, and civil engineering projects.

2.Q: What main advantages do Welded Gabions have compared to woven varieties?
    A: Key benefits include:

Improved Stiffness: Welded joints form rigid panels that keep their shape when under pressure.

Precise Dimensions: Allows for accurate shapes, uniform profiles, and even surfaces.

Faster Installation: Pre-built parts allow for quicker setup than woven systems.

Reliable Fill Holding: Structural solidity stops aggregates from moving and gaps from forming after installation.

4.Q: Explain how Welded Gabions are installed?
    A: Key stages are:

On-site Joining: Connecting pre-made parts (base, walls, diaphragms, lid) using spiral connectors or strong rings.

Placement: Putting empty units in place according to design plans.

Filling: Adding angular stones (usually 75–200mm) by hand or machine, making sure not to damage the mesh.

Sealing: Securing lids after filling with twist fasteners or rings.

5.Q: What are the main places where Welded Gabion systems are used?
    A: Primary uses include:

Slope Stabilization: Gravity walls for excavations, transportation routes, and ground adjustment.

Landscaping: Constructing walls, garden features, planters, seating, and decorative elements that require precise shapes.

Hydraulic Defense: Protecting streambeds and lining channels to resist erosive water flow.

Noise Reduction: Being part of motorway noise barriers.

Security Barriers: High-capacity obstacles for protection and blast resistance, taking advantage of their better load-bearing and energy absorbing properties.
